Amphastar Q2 Revenue Climbs 5% to $183.9M, GAAP EPS $0.67; BAQSIMI Milestone Triggers $100M Payment

Summary

Amphastar's Q2 revenue rose 5% to $183.9M, but earnings dipped. A BAQSIMI sales milestone triggers a $100M payment to Lilly, while an FDA Warning Letter at its IMS plant adds regulatory risk.


Key Events · Earnings and Guidance · AMPH

  • Q2 Revenue Up 5%, Earnings Dip

    Net revenues of $183.9M (+5% YoY) were driven by new products; GAAP EPS came in at $0.67 versus $0.64 a year ago, but net income fell 2% to $30.3M as operating expenses rose 21%.

  • BAQSIMI Milestone Triggers $100M Payment

    BAQSIMI annual net sales reached $175M, triggering a $100M milestone payment to Eli Lilly due in Q3 2026 — a significant cash outflow that will reduce liquidity.

  • FDA Warning Letter at IMS Facility

    Subsidiary IMS received an FDA Warning Letter for cGMP violations; remediation is underway, and management expects no material financial impact, but regulatory risk remains.

  • Strong Operating Cash Flow, Aggressive Buybacks

    H1 2026 operating cash flow was $99.2M, but the company spent $74.7M on share repurchases, raising concerns about capital allocation ahead of the $100M milestone payment.


Analysis · AMPH · Life Sciences

Amphastar turned in a mixed quarter. Revenue grew 5% to $183.9 million, fueled by new product launches, but net income slipped 2% as operating expenses jumped 21% on higher R&D and legal costs. The standout development is the BAQSIMI sales milestone — hitting $175 million in annual sales triggers a $100 million payment to Eli Lilly due next quarter, a significant cash outflow that will pressure liquidity. Gross margins improved slightly, and the company generated strong operating cash flow of $99 million in the first half, yet aggressive share buybacks ($74.7 million) and the looming milestone payment raise questions about capital allocation. Adding to the overhang, the FDA Warning Letter at the IMS facility introduces regulatory risk, though management expects limited financial impact.
